The moratorium on shale gas exploration and extraction using hydraulic fracturing is only a temporary measure which hinders economic activity, the country's environment minister said.

In January 2012 Bulgaria imposed an indefinite ban on shale gas exploration and extraction using hydraulic fracturing, or fracking. The ban applies to Bulgaria's whole territory andthe country's Black Sea territorial waters, carrying a fine of 100 million levs.

Each project should be considered individually, and if found to be safe and in compliance with the country's environmental laws, it should be given the green light, Iskra Mihailova told private bTV station. The ban is no solution, she added.
